Artist Biography

Paul Winter is an American saxophonist and composer known for his innovative blend of jazz, world music, and nature sounds. Born in 1939 in Altoona, Pennsylvania, Winter began playing the saxophone at a young age and quickly developed a passion for music. He studied at Northwestern University and the Eastman School of Music before embarking on a successful career in the music industry. In the 1960s, Winter formed the Paul Winter Consort, a group that became known for its unique fusion of jazz and classical music with influences from around the world. Winter's music often incorporates sounds from nature, inspired by his love for the environment and his experiences performing in natural settings such as the Grand Canyon and the Amazon rainforest. Throughout his career, Winter has released numerous albums and won multiple Grammy Awards for his recordings. He is also a dedicated environmentalist and has used his music to raise awareness about conservation issues. Paul Winter's pioneering approach to music continues to inspire audiences around the world.
